Raise this gutshot?
MP3 is 32/14/2.37
Preflop: Hero is BB with 6 [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img] 5 [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img] 3 folds, MP1 calls, MP2 calls, MP3 raises, 3 folds, Hero calls, MP1 calls, MP2 calls. Flop: (8.40 SB) 9 [img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img] 7 [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img] 7 [img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img] (4 players) Hero checks, MP1 checks, MP2 checks, MP3 bets, Hero... Call/Raise? |

Re: Raise this gutshot?
[ QUOTE ]
MP3 is 32/14/2.37 Preflop: Hero is BB with 6 [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img] 5 [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img] 3 folds, MP1 calls, MP2 calls, MP3 raises, 3 folds, Hero calls, MP1 calls, MP2 calls. Flop: (8.40 SB) 9 [img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img] 7 [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img] 7 [img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img] (4 players) Hero checks, MP1 checks, MP2 checks, MP3 bets, Hero... Call/Raise? [/ QUOTE ] You have a gutshot, but it's not to the nuts. You have a backdoor flush draw, but the board is paired. You can't really buy any outs with a raise (i.e. it's not like you care very much if a bigger 5 or 6 folds). I probably call 1 small bet, but I certainly don't raise. |

Re: Raise this gutshot?
[ QUOTE ]
The pot should offer you better odds on this board. It could easily get raised behind you if you call. Folding here is far from out of the question. [/ QUOTE ] I agree. Another thing to consider is our position to the bettor and how that affects our implied odds. Also, as we all know, a paired board can mean trouble, if not already drawing dead. We're certainly not losing much be folding, and it very well may be the best play. |
